Pragmatic Play acquires live casino supplier from Novomatic
Games provider aims to tap into the popularity of live casino with purchase of Extreme Live Gaming
Games provider Pragmatic Play has acquired Novomatic’s live casino solutions firm Extreme Live Gaming for an undisclosed amount.
The acquisition will see Pragmatic Play add Extreme Live Gaming’s selection of live dealer games to its existing range of verticals alongside video slots, scratchcards and bingo.
Extreme Live Gaming operates ten roulette, blackjack and baccarat tables from its London studios and is certified by the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) and the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A).
Pragmatic Play CCO Melissa Summerfield said: “The name Extreme Live Gaming stands for quality and innovation, and we are delighted to enhance our multi-vertical gaming strategy with this acquisition, further cementing our position as a leading industry provider.
“The popularity of live casino has grown hugely in recent years, and the vertical holds a great deal of potential.
“We have every confidence that our passion and drive for going beyond our clients and players’ expectations will help us to realise that potential,” she added.
RB Capital co-founder Julian Buhagiar said of the deal: “This could well be a relatively inexpensive acquisition and savvy diversification play, particularly if it is looking to further expand its operator-customer base in Scandinavia and, more importantly, across Asia, a market that suits Extreme’s product portfolio and where players lean towards live casino products.
“It’s not often you see M&A movement in the live casino space largely due to dominant players including Evolution, Playtech, and relative newcomers NetEnt, claiming the lions’ share of the European market,” he added.
